The Automated Parcel Delivery Terminals Market is projected to reach USD 1.02 Billion in 2026. It is expected to continue growing at a CAGR of 11.20%, reaching USD 1.94 Billion by 2032.

Automated parcel delivery terminals, also known as smart parcel lockers, automated parcel lockers, and out-of-home delivery terminals, are becoming a critical part of last-mile delivery infrastructure. The sector is being shaped by sustained e-commerce demand, higher parcel density in cities, carrier pressure to reduce failed delivery attempts, and consumer preference for secure, self-service pickup options available beyond traditional delivery windows.

For logistics providers, retailers, postal operators, property owners, and technology vendors, parcel terminal networks offer a measurable route to improve delivery consolidation, reduce doorstep theft exposure, and support reverse logistics. Verified industry signals from postal operators, transportation agencies, retail fulfillment networks, and public disclosures consistently show that unattended pickup points are moving from a convenience feature to a strategic logistics asset.

Transformative Shifts in the Parcel Terminal Landscape

The automated parcel delivery terminal landscape is shifting from isolated locker installations to integrated, data-driven delivery ecosystems. Retailers and carriers are increasingly deploying open-network lockers, carrier-agnostic parcel hubs, residential package rooms, campus delivery systems, and transit-linked pickup terminals to improve first-attempt delivery performance and customer convenience.

Several structural shifts are accelerating adoption. Urbanization is increasing delivery stop density, while labor availability and route economics are pushing carriers toward consolidated drop-off models. At the same time, consumer expectations shaped by same-day, next-day, and flexible delivery options are raising the value of 24/7 access, secure authentication, mobile notifications, real-time locker availability, and easy returns.

Cumulative Impact of Artificial Intelligence

Artificial intelligence is having a cumulative impact across the automated parcel delivery terminal value chain. AI-enabled demand forecasting helps operators predict parcel volume by location, season, and time of day, improving locker allocation and reducing overflow. Machine learning models also support dynamic routing, courier workload balancing, and predictive maintenance for locker hardware such as doors, sensors, screens, and payment or authentication modules.

AI is also strengthening customer experience and operational security. Computer vision, anomaly detection, fraud analytics, and intelligent access management can help detect misuse, improve audit trails, and reduce service disruptions. As parcel terminal networks scale, the advantage increasingly shifts to operators that can combine physical locker density with AI-driven software orchestration, accurate data governance, cybersecurity readiness, and interoperable carrier integration.

Key Regional Insights: Global Parcel Locker Adoption

Asia-Pacific is one of the most dynamic regions for automated parcel delivery terminals because of high e-commerce activity, dense metropolitan corridors, and strong mobile payment adoption. China, Japan, South Korea, India, Australia, and ASEAN markets are expanding use cases across residential communities, transit stations, office towers, convenience stores, and retail pickup networks. The region’s scale supports both closed carrier networks and increasingly interoperable models, particularly where digital identity, app-based notifications, and cashless payments are widely used.

North America is advancing through carrier-led, retailer-led, and residential real estate deployments, with the United States and Canada emphasizing secure package delivery for multifamily housing, campuses, corporate offices, and omnichannel retail. Latin America is emerging as retailers and logistics providers address urban congestion, address quality variation, and rising cross-border e-commerce flows, with Brazil and Mexico standing out for parcel volume potential, marketplace activity, and the need for more dependable delivery and returns infrastructure.

Europe has a mature out-of-home delivery culture supported by postal operators, parcel shops, sustainability policies, dense urban infrastructure, and consumer familiarity with pickup alternatives. The Middle East is building modern logistics networks around smart city investments, e-commerce growth, and high mobile connectivity, particularly across GCC markets. Africa remains earlier in adoption but presents long-term opportunity where terminals can improve delivery reliability in urban centers, support structured e-commerce fulfillment, and complement mobile-first retail ecosystems.

Key Group Insights Across Trade and Economic Blocs

ASEAN markets are gaining relevance as e-commerce platforms, convenience retail, and third-party logistics providers expand parcel pickup coverage across Indonesia, Thailand, Vietnam, Malaysia, Singapore, and the Philippines. The region’s fragmented geography, dense cities, and rapid mobile commerce growth make automated terminals attractive for consolidated delivery, especially in transit-linked locations, mixed-use developments, residential towers, and convenience retail networks.

The GCC is aligning automated parcel delivery terminals with smart city programs, premium retail environments, digitally enabled postal modernization, and high smartphone penetration. The European Union benefits from common regulatory attention to sustainability, data protection, consumer rights, accessibility, and cross-border parcel services, all of which support structured out-of-home delivery networks. BRICS economies represent a large demand base because of population scale, e-commerce expansion, urbanization, and infrastructure modernization, though deployment maturity varies significantly by country and city tier.

G7 markets generally show higher readiness because of advanced logistics infrastructure, established postal and carrier networks, high card and digital payment usage, and broad consumer familiarity with e-commerce delivery options. NATO countries overlap with many mature parcel markets in North America and Europe, where resilient logistics, cybersecurity, infrastructure continuity, and secure authentication are increasingly important to public and private-sector delivery planning.

Key Country Insights for Automated Parcel Delivery Terminals

The United States leads in large-scale residential, retail, and carrier-enabled parcel terminal deployments, supported by high e-commerce spending, a large multifamily housing base, and strong demand for secure package management. Canada is expanding adoption in urban residential buildings and retail pickup networks, while Mexico is using lockers and pickup points to address delivery reliability, urban congestion, address standardization challenges, and cross-border commerce. Brazil is a major Latin American opportunity as marketplaces, fintech-enabled commerce, parcel carrier networks, and urban delivery infrastructure mature.

In Europe, the United Kingdom combines strong online retail penetration with growing out-of-home delivery adoption and a mature parcel carrier ecosystem. Germany and France benefit from established parcel networks, postal infrastructure, consumer acceptance of pickup points, and sustainability-driven delivery consolidation. Italy and Spain are advancing through retail partnerships, parcel shop integration, and urban delivery optimization, while Russia’s large geography makes pickup infrastructure relevant for delivery efficiency where network coverage, urban density, and local operating conditions support feasible deployment.

In Asia-Pacific, China has a highly developed parcel terminal ecosystem supported by large parcel volumes, dense urban communities, and digital platform integration. India’s opportunity is tied to rapid e-commerce growth, urbanization, mobile-first retail, and the need for reliable pickup options across diverse address systems. Japan and South Korea show strong fit because of dense cities, advanced logistics practices, high technology adoption, and consumer acceptance of automated services. Australia is adopting terminals in residential, retail, and workplace settings to improve delivery convenience across dispersed urban and suburban markets.

Actionable Recommendations for Industry Leaders

Industry leaders should prioritize location intelligence, interoperability, and service reliability when scaling automated parcel delivery terminals. High-performing networks are typically placed where parcel density, foot traffic, dwell time, and consumer convenience intersect, including multifamily buildings, transit nodes, universities, office campuses, grocery stores, shopping centers, and mixed-use developments.

Operators should invest in open APIs, carrier integration, AI-enabled capacity forecasting, uptime monitoring, and cybersecurity controls from the start. Retailers should connect lockers to omnichannel workflows, click-and-collect services, returns management, and customer loyalty systems. Property owners should evaluate terminals as amenity infrastructure that reduces package room congestion, improves tenant experience, and supports measurable operational savings through fewer manual package handling tasks.
